Title: having trouble printing .ai file from adobe....
Post by: dndcollect on July 17, 2007, 07:02:31 pm
I am trying to print a marquee from an .ai file in adobe reader. however it is only showing the center of the image and the 2 sides are cut off. i have been trying to get it to print the complete picture but i am stumped.

anyone know what to do?
Title: Re: having trouble printing .ai file from adobe....
Post by: zorg on July 18, 2007, 05:34:42 am
that's because the "document format" is inacurate.

easy to fix see pics bellow, some screenshot to help (in french, but the image speak by themselves)

open the file, select all
open the dimension palete and check the dimension of the artwork
(http://edeveaud.free.fr/tuto_doc/Picture%202.png)
then in file menu change the document size accordingly.
(http://edeveaud.free.fr/tuto_doc/Picture%203.png)
(http://edeveaud.free.fr/tuto_doc/Picture%201.png)
print and voila :D
